Peisaj Veneția is a print by Adam Bălțatu. It dates from 1939 and is held in the collection of the Brukenthal National Museum.

Subject & Meaning

The work captures a tranquil Venetian scene, with buildings along the water's edge, featuring arched doorways and windows, and a moored boat. The serene atmosphere invites the viewer into a peaceful world.

Technique & Style

The painting is characterized by muted tones with touches of red and green, and a soft blue sky with wispy clouds. The use of chiaroscuro creates a sense of depth and interplay between light and shadow.
